Output 807f750d19d7c6e1732c4919acfe812456bf01251639e6d934f2e0a546e3068c:3

value
15432350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ff5207e1294fcf75f1fb0714aca33cd4d2e4286 OP_EQUAL
address
3DMbPd7akJE4hgDugreu6xkq1AKvhY4f2g
transaction
807f750d19d7c6e1732c4919acfe812456bf01251639e6d934f2e0a546e3068c
spent
true